aboutsummaryrefslogtreecommitdiffstats
path: root/wpa_supplicant/Makefile
diff options
context:
space:
mode:
authorJouni Malinen <j@w1.fi>2017-02-16 18:37:19 (GMT)
committerJouni Malinen <j@w1.fi>2017-02-16 20:15:29 (GMT)
commit62944f7d2cb004030b96a5e114752692fb4ea756 (patch)
tree2f77350d40f30519995220cc2117aec0632bf2c5 /wpa_supplicant/Makefile
parentaeecd4eaec6939562b6e5815795b117f7eaa2b9f (diff)
downloadhostap-62944f7d2cb004030b96a5e114752692fb4ea756.zip
hostap-62944f7d2cb004030b96a5e114752692fb4ea756.tar.gz
hostap-62944f7d2cb004030b96a5e114752692fb4ea756.tar.bz2
Add HMAC-SHA384 with internal crypto
This is a copy of the internal HMAC-SHA256 implementation with the hash block size and output length updated to match SHA384 parameters. Signed-off-by: Jouni Malinen <j@w1.fi>
Diffstat (limited to 'wpa_supplicant/Makefile')
-rw-r--r--wpa_supplicant/Makefile3
1 files changed, 3 insertions, 0 deletions
diff --git a/wpa_supplicant/Makefile b/wpa_supplicant/Makefile
index 4455dca..91ea4d2 100644
--- a/wpa_supplicant/Makefile
+++ b/wpa_supplicant/Makefile
@@ -1330,6 +1330,9 @@ endif
OBJS += $(SHA256OBJS)
endif
ifdef NEED_SHA384
+ifneq ($(CONFIG_TLS), openssl)
+OBJS += ../src/crypto/sha384.o
+endif
CFLAGS += -DCONFIG_SHA384
OBJS += ../src/crypto/sha384-prf.o
endif